Output 95f417a984b9974e73a5899a51bfbd0fd3ede9c2da51f0f0f370828d2521c004:0

value
31526000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d272c460b249416dc54175e6fca4b69ee7e4468 OP_EQUAL
address
3ABZhAgqqDuZveEJvXLTiE4SwUs7LkmwNF
transaction
95f417a984b9974e73a5899a51bfbd0fd3ede9c2da51f0f0f370828d2521c004
spent
true